Output 62afbeb19d68e42892b1a17734c2911cae1b5374d2b8578de028db7188885623:2

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59a608353fed0f5b2ddad166dcf3062c957ffd51 OP_EQUAL
address
39s2xj6ZR2HrX8o6US3hUmA4XMFCKE9FjD
transaction
62afbeb19d68e42892b1a17734c2911cae1b5374d2b8578de028db7188885623
spent
true